Insurance Regulations in Delaware

Key regulatory requirements for businesses operating in DE.

Required

Workers' Compensation Insurance

Required for employers with 1+ employee.

Exempt categories:

  • Sole proprietors
  • Partners
  • LLC members

Commercial Auto Minimum Liability

$25,000/$50,000/$10,000 (bodily injury per person / per accident / property damage)

Source: Delaware Department of Insurance, U.S. Department of Labor

Yes, because the main risk is often not physical damage but allegations that advice, analysis, or services caused a client loss. Professional Liability Insurance can help with errors and omissions claims, including defense costs and related settlement expenses.

Cyber Liability Insurance can help with client data breaches, ransomware response, forensic investigations, notification costs, and certain recovery expenses. It is especially important if your firm stores financial records, tax documents, case files, or other sensitive information.

General Liability Insurance can help if a client slips in your office, if you accidentally damage a client’s property during a meeting, or if you face certain third-party injury or property damage claims. It does not usually replace Professional Liability Insurance for advice-related mistakes.

A Business Owners Policy Insurance package can be a practical option for firms that need property coverage and business interruption protection along with liability coverage. It may work well for smaller offices, but firms with higher professional exposure usually still need separate Professional Liability Insurance and Cyber Liability Insurance.

That is where Commercial Umbrella Insurance may help by adding extra liability limits above your underlying policies. It can be useful for firms that work with large clients, sign broad contract terms, or need to meet vendor and procurement requirements.

Business interruption can disrupt access to files, client meetings, billing, and service delivery after a fire, cyber event, or other covered loss. A Business Owners Policy Insurance may help address certain income losses and extra expenses, depending on the cause of the interruption and the policy terms.
